Overlooking occlusal relationships, it was typical to get rid of teeth for a selection of dental issues, such as malalignment or overcrowding. The concept of an intact teeth was not commonly valued in those days, making bite connections seem irrelevant. In the late 1800s, the principle of occlusion was vital for creating reliable prosthetic substitute teeth.


As these ideas of prosthetic occlusion proceeded, it became an important device for dentistry. It was in 1890 that the job and effect of Dr. Edwards H. Angle started to be felt, with his contribution to modern orthodontics especially notable. Concentrated on prosthodontics, he taught in Pennsylvania and Minnesota before guiding his focus towards dental occlusion and the treatments needed to keep it as a normal problem, hence becoming known as the "daddy of contemporary orthodontics".

The idea of excellent occlusion, as proposed by Angle and incorporated right into a category system, made it possible for a shift in the direction of dealing with malocclusion, which is any type of discrepancy from normal occlusion. Having a complete set of teeth on both arcs was very searched for in orthodontic treatment as a result of the requirement for exact relationships in between them.

To accomplish optimal occlusals without making use of exterior forces, Angle postulated that having excellent occlusion was the most effective means to get optimal face looks. With the passing away of time, it became quite noticeable that also an exceptional occlusion was not suitable when considered from a visual perspective




Charles Tweed in America and Raymond Begg in Australia (who both studied under Angle) re-introduced dentistry extraction into orthodontics throughout the 1940s and 1950s so they can boost face esthetics while additionally ensuring far better security worrying occlusal partnerships. In the postwar duration, cephalometric radiography begun to be used by orthodontists for determining adjustments in tooth and jaw placement brought on by development and treatment. It became apparent that orthodontic therapy can readjust mandibular advancement, causing the formation of functional jaw orthopedics in Europe and extraoral force actions in the United States. Nowadays, both functional home appliances and extraoral gadgets are applied around the globe with the purpose of modifying development patterns and types. As a result, going after true, or at the very least enhanced, jaw connections had become the primary objective of treatment by the mid-20th century.
